Last Minute Scrambling – 1 day to go

Gear for Camping Piles

A thousand days of planning and somehow I am left scrambling the day before. We were making good progress but then our youngest got sick the other day and that threw a wrench into things. We are just happy she had wrapped up the last of her play dates and birthday parties this past weekend. So for the last couple of days, she’s been staying at home watching me attempt to fit a ridiculous amount of gear into a finite space. That and watching TV. I think she knows TV will be hard to come by and is getting all the viewing she can right now.

Anyways, we’ve crossed off a bunch of loose ends this last week.

Storage – We rented a small locker to store the items our renters probably don’t need or want to see. It is pretty much full now. One final run to today and then I will padlock it and see it again in a year. I am embarrassed to say it, but I would not be upset if 75% of the stuff were to disappear.

Get rid of some Stuff – The final boxes of free stuff were put outside on the curb. Thanks to the many good neighbours who gave some of our children’s toys a second life. Someone even took the 2000 Mini Cooper Wheel Lock Keys!

House Repairs – An unexpected sink repair popped up this week which I had to tackle but I think we are done on this front. So fingers crossed, the house is in better shape than when we bought it. We tested the new AC at full blast this week and it works great.

Deal with the Car – We looked at a bunch of different options and decided not to sell. A good friend said he can use the car for a year so we took the car seats out and dropped off the keys this weekend with him. Like the house, the car looked the best it had since I drove it off the lot 4 years ago.

Kids’ social lives – The final playdates and birthdays are in the books, and the kids have been collecting their friends’ addresses for postcards. Swimming lessons and gymnastics wrapped up this past week with ribbons, medals and badges aplenty.

Empty the Fridge – We haven’t really bought groceries in a couple weeks. Sugar has been replaced with palm sugar – I’ve been eating frozen pies crusts and everything has sprinkles on it – joking aside it is slim picking and I haven’t had an egg in weeks. We also finished a bottle of Disaronno that we had from 8 years ago.

Prep the Jeep – The jeep is clean, serviced and ready for us to load up later today. I even washed the car seats.

Clean the House – Why is it our houses always look the best when we are leaving them? – the porch is painted, the cabinets are scrubbed and all the appliances have gone through a self-cleaning cycle with their filters all replaced!

We take off tomorrow and we’ll see how it goes. The first few days are with family to ease us into things. Paigey and I just hope the kids are as good travellers as they were before the pandemic. It has been a long time and we’ve got our fingers crossed.
